Ingredients

For the Salad

  • 1 can organic black beans (drained and rinsed)
  • 2 cups corn kernels (fresh or frozen)
  • 1 red bell pepper, diced
  • 1 jalapeno, finely diced
  • 1/4 cup red onion, finely diced
  • 1/2 cup fresh cilantro, chopped
  • 2 tbsp. fresh lime juice
  • 1/2 tsp. salt
  • fresh black pepper to taste

How to Make Corn and Black Bean Salad

Step 1: Combine Ingredients

  1. In a mixing bowl, add all the prepared ingredients: black beans, corn kernels, diced red bell pepper, jalapeno, red onion, cilantro, lime juice, salt, and black pepper.
  2. Gently stir until all elements are combined well.
  3. Taste the salad; adjust seasoning by adding more salt or lime juice if desired.

How to Perfect Corn and Black Bean Salad

Making the perfect Corn and Black Bean Salad is all about balance and freshness. Here are some tips to elevate your dish.

  • Use fresh ingredients – Fresh corn and ripe vegetables make the salad more flavorful.
  • Adjust seasoning – Taste before serving; add more lime juice or salt as needed.
  • Let it marinate – Allowing the salad to sit for at least 30 minutes helps flavors meld together.
  • Add texture – Consider adding diced avocado or crumbled feta cheese for creaminess.
  • Experiment with spices – A pinch of cumin or chili powder can add an exciting twist.
  • Serve cold – Chill before serving to enhance the refreshing taste of the salad.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Making the perfect Corn and Black Bean Salad is easy, but some common mistakes can ruin it. Here are a few pitfalls to watch out for.

  • Using canned beans without rinsing: Always rinse canned black beans to remove excess sodium and improve flavor.
  • Skipping the lime juice: Lime juice adds brightness and balances flavors. Don’t skip it; adjust to your taste.
  • Overseasoning with salt: Start with a little salt, as you can always add more. Taste before adjusting.
  • Ignoring fresh ingredients: Fresh cilantro and peppers elevate this salad. Avoid using stale or low-quality produce.
  • Not letting it sit: Allow the salad to rest for at least 15 minutes before serving. This helps the flavors meld together.
